Ose Dudu, commonly called African Black Soap is ranked high on the ‘might cause magic’ list alongside Harry Potter and David Blaine for no other reason than it kicks some major clean Bottom. While the recipe varies, ABS is handmade from the ashes of cocoa pods, shea tree bark and plaintain leaves and mixed with various soothing and healing oils such as shea butter, palm oil and coconut oil, creating its deliciously distinct aroma. And don’t let it’s appearance fool you — although dark brown and crumbly in texture, this African-born skin miracle will become a staple in your cleansing routine. It’s benefits are awesome and severely underrated, so we’re shouting them from the rooftops. Here’s why ABS is so amazing: It’s suitable for all skin types. Whether you’re skin is a dry gulch or an oil-monger (or somewhere perfectly in between), black soap is well advised. If you’re on the oily side of the coin, regular use will help remove additional oils from the skin thus preventing the formation of pimples It’s a super cleanser. Well of course, it’s soap, duh. But wait — there’s more. The charcoal in ABS can help absorb body odors and bacteria, while its formula is gentle enough for makeup removal. It’s soothing + healing. This double whammy is perhaps the most notable. If you suffer with rashes or skin conditions such as eczema and psoriasis, the ashes in black soap helps reduce irritation and can even be used by people with sensitive skin. While ABS cannot remove acne, since that is caused by the release of excessive oils within the skin rather than dirt buildup, it can reduce the appearance of acne scars. It’s a fountain of youth.
